Metavista3D Enters into MOU with VIN International to Develop 3D Camera Prototype for Vehicles

Metavista3D, announces that, further to its press release of December 6, 2024, the Company has entered into a memorandum of understanding (the “MOU”) with VIN International FZCO (“VIN”) to co-develop an automotive safety prototype and demonstration unit featuring 3D spatial camera systems. VIN is a member of the VIN Group, with subsidiaries in Dubai, the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, and Bahrain. VIN is a leading provider of advanced safety and security technologies for luxury and heavy-duty vehicles. Its product portfolio includes road safety devices such as construction site safety solutions, fatigue monitoring systems, vehicle cameras, and collision avoidance systems.

As the automotive industry continues to evolve, this collaboration focuses on integrating 3D spatial camera systems to support advancements in vehicle safety and operational efficiency, which currently rely on 2D technology. The collaboration is expected to expand VIN Technology Systems’ product portfolio with tools designed to detect and address safety risks in real-time. The MOU reflects a mutual interest in exploring potential long-term partnership opportunities which brings together the technical capabilities of both companies to address evolving safety requirements in the Middle East market.

“Our collaboration with VIN Technology Systems reflects a shared focus on bringing technological solutions to the automotive, truck, and heavy vehicle sectors,” said Jeff Carlson, CEO of Metavista3D. “By combining our expertise in glasses-free 3D visualization with VIN Technology Systems’ extensive experience in vehicle safety, we aim to develop practical solutions that improve spatial awareness and enhance overall safety on the road.”
